溫馨提示×

SQL Server差異備份包含什么

小樊
84
2024-11-01 13:27:11
欄目: 云計算

SQL Server差異備份包含自最近一次完整備份以來發(fā)生更改的所有數(shù)據(jù)。這意味著差異備份僅備份自上次完整備份后發(fā)生變化的數(shù)據(jù)塊,而不是整個數(shù)據(jù)庫。以下是差異備份的相關(guān)信息:

差異備份的定義

差異備份是基于最近一次完整備份的,它只包含自那次完整備份以來發(fā)生更改的數(shù)據(jù)。這種備份類型適用于那些數(shù)據(jù)變動不是非常頻繁的數(shù)據(jù)庫,因為它可以節(jié)省備份時間和存儲空間。

差異備份與全備份和增量備份的區(qū)別

  • 全備份:備份全部選中的文件夾,不依賴文件的存檔屬性來確定備份哪些文件。
  • 增量備份:備份自上一次備份(包含完全備份、差異備份、增量備份)之后有變化的數(shù)據(jù)。

差異備份的優(yōu)缺點

  • 優(yōu)點:差異備份的創(chuàng)建和恢復復雜性低于增量備份,略高于完全備份。它結(jié)合了完整備份和增量備份的優(yōu)點,備份速度快,恢復所需時間較短。
  • 缺點:如果完整備份損壞,差異備份可能無法恢復數(shù)據(jù)。此外,隨著差異備份的積累,備份文件可能會變得非常大,增加恢復時的復雜性。

差異備份的工作原理

差異備份的工作原理是備份自上次完整備份以來發(fā)生更改的數(shù)據(jù)塊。每個數(shù)據(jù)塊都有一個位圖標記,指示其是否自上次備份以來發(fā)生了變化。差異備份的大小取決于自上次完整備份以來更改的數(shù)據(jù)量。

差異備份的恢復過程

在恢復差異備份時,必須先還原最近的完整備份,然后再還原差異備份。這是因為差異備份依賴于完整備份作為恢復的基礎(chǔ)。

通過上述信息,您可以更好地理解SQL Server差異備份的內(nèi)容、工作原理以及其在數(shù)據(jù)恢復中的應(yīng)用。

0